Anthropic通过为Claude Code引入远程模型上下文协议(MCP)服务器支持,显著简化了AI与现有开发工具的集成,使开发者无需本地配置即可安全地访问外部资源。这一升级不仅提升了便利性,更被业界视为可能改变AI工具集成经济、推动AI在复杂软件工程场景中更深层应用的关键一步。
近期,人工智能公司Anthropic为旗下代码生成和理解工具Claude Code带来了一项重要更新:对远程模型上下文协议(MCP)服务器的支持。这项功能允许开发人员在不进行传统本地服务器设置的情况下,直接将Claude Code与现有的外部工具和资源无缝集成,例如安全服务、项目管理系统和知识库等。此举旨在降低集成门槛,使AI模型能更轻松地从多样化的开发环境中获取上下文信息,进而提升其在实际工程场景中的实用性与效率。
技术原理解析与集成范式变革
长期以来,将大型语言模型(LLM)与复杂的外部系统连接一直是一项技术挑战。为了让AI模型能够访问实时数据或执行特定操作,通常需要开发者自行配置本地服务器作为模型与外部工具之间的“翻译层”。Anthropic此次推出的远程MCP服务器支持,正是为了解决这一痛点。它提供了一种_低维护成本_的替代方案,开发者只需将供应商提供的URL添加到Claude Code中,无需再手动管理服务器基础设施,如配置、更新和扩展等繁琐任务。12
这项新功能的核心在于其对流式HTTP(streaming HTTP)和OAuth 2.0的内置支持。通过流式HTTP,Claude Code可以替代传统的stdio(标准输入/输出)方式,实现更高效、更灵活的数据传输,从而更好地与远程MCP服务器进行通信。3 同时,对OAuth 2.0的原生支持意味着开发者可以直接通过终端进行身份验证,例如将Claude Code连接到GitHub MCP服务器时,只需执行简单的命令:
$ claude mcp add --transport sse github-server https://api.github.com/mcp
该命令会触发一个交互式菜单,引导开发者通过浏览器完成OAuth认证,之后Claude Code会自动在本地存储访问令牌,确保连接的安全性和便捷性。14 这一改进,将开发者从底层服务器管理的负担中解放出来,使其能够更专注于利用AI解决实际的工程问题,无疑改变了AI工具与传统软件栈的集成范式。
成本效益与应用边界的再审视
尽管Reddit上一些开发者对这项更新的重要性持保守态度,认为其“远不能改变游戏规则”4,但前Tripadvisor产品工程负责人、现任Fractional首席技术官的Robert Matsukoa却提供了更深远的洞察。他指出,这_“不仅仅是一个方便的升级”,而是一个将“改变AI工具集成经济”_的关键一步。5
Matsukoa认为,远程服务器显著消除了本地MCP部署所需的基础设施成本,团队不再需要为配置服务器、管理更新或处理MCP服务的扩展而投入资源。然而,他也审慎地指出,使用MCP服务器通常会因从外部资源中提取更大规模的上下文而增加约25-30%的运营成本。远程MCP的便捷性,反而可能因为更容易进行大规模上下文提取而放大这些成本。因此,关键在于_明智地选择何时使用_。5
Matsukoa强调,MCP的真正优势体现在那些需要_深度上下文集成_的场景:例如多存储库调试会话、需要历史上下文的遗留系统分析,或同时结合多个数据源的复杂工作流程。当Claude需要在工具交互之间维护状态或关联来自不同系统的信息时,该协议能发挥出卓越的性能。相反,对于基于CLI(命令行界面)和标准API的简单工作流程,他认为没有必要绕道MCP。5 这一观点为开发者提供了重要的指导,帮助他们权衡便利性与实际需求,避免不必要的成本开销。
推动AI与传统软件的深度融合
Anthropic此举的深远影响,在于它进一步模糊了AI与传统软件工程之间的界限。通过提供更流畅、更安全的远程集成方式,Claude Code能够更紧密地融入到现有的开发工具链和企业级系统中,使AI不仅是独立的工具,更是开发者日常工作流中不可或缺的智能协作伙伴。
这为构建更自主化、上下文感知的AI Agent奠定了基础。随着AI模型能够轻松访问项目管理系统中的任务状态、安全服务中的漏洞信息或代码仓库中的历史变更记录,它们将能够执行更复杂、更智能的决策和操作,从而提高软件开发的效率和质量。Anthropic已经发布了一份与合作伙伴共同开发的官方MCP服务器列表6,而GitHub社区也维护着一个更广泛的集合7,预示着一个更加开放和互联的AI工具生态系统正在形成。
在AI技术加速与各行各业深度融合的当下,Anthropic的远程MCP服务器支持,代表着大模型在企业级应用落地上迈出的关键一步。它不仅是技术上的精进,更是对未来软件开发模式的一次深刻思考:如何让AI以最自然、最高效的方式,成为人类工程师的延伸,共同应对日益复杂的数字挑战。
引文
-
Remote MCP support in Claude Code - Anthropic · Anthropic (2025/6/25)· 检索日期2025/6/25 ↩︎ ↩︎
-
Claude Code通过流式HTTP获得对远程MCP服务器的支持 · InfoQ · (无作者) (2025/6/25)· 检索日期2025/6/25 ↩︎
-
Reddit 讨论:comment/myj0002 · Reddit (2025/6/25)· 检索日期2025/6/25 ↩︎
-
Reddit 讨论:Claude Code now supports remote MCP servers, no local server setup required · Reddit (2025/6/25)· 检索日期2025/6/25 ↩︎ ↩︎
-
Claude Code Remote MCP - Hyperdev by Robert Matsukoa · Hyperdev by Robert Matsukoa · Robert Matsukoa (2025/6/25)· 检索日期2025/6/25 ↩︎ ↩︎ ↩︎
-
MCP Server Partnerships - Anthropic · Anthropic (2025/6/25)· 检索日期2025/6/25 ↩︎
-
GitHub: jaw9c/awesome-remote-mcp-servers · GitHub (2025/6/25)· 检索日期2025/6/25 ↩︎